Dynamic Physical Therapy is a boutique style physical therapy clinic located in River North that focuses on one-on-one care to help you achieve your goals. We offer "hands on" care and personalized rehabilitation programs to ensure the highest quality of care. Each session includes manual treatment such as cupping, dry needling and mobilizations, therapeutic exercise, patient education, and behavioral modification strategies. Dynamic Physical Therapy treats all orthopedic and sports conditions including issues with shoulders, wrists, elbows, hips, knees, ankles, back and neck. We also now provide pelvic floor rehabilitation, which includes pelvic pain, incontinence, organ prolapse, pelvic muscle dysfunction, diastasis recti, pre and post natal. We are passionate about our profession and are committed to providing high quality, individualized care for a complete return to function. Meredith Franczyk, PT, MPT
Meredith Franczyk founded Dynamic Physical Therapy Chicago River North in September of 2017. Meredith earned her Masters Degree in Physical Therapy from Northern Illinois University in 2002. She specializes in manual therapy, neuromuscular re-education, postural dysfunction, general orthopedics such as knee, back and shoulder pain, sports injuries, dry needling and overuse injuries. Meredith particularly enjoys working with endurance athletes with an emphasis on runners. She has voluntereed for various Chicago running groups, events and blogs. Meredith is a long distance runner herself and has a strong passion for the activity. Overall, she focuses on treating each individual as a whole and not just focusing on the symptoms.

Mary Buzzard, PT, DPT, OCS, CMTPT/DN
Mary Buzzard earned her Doctor of Physical Therapy degree from the University of Illinois at Chicago in 2016 and is also a board-certified orthopedic clinical specialist (OCS). Mary has been practicing at the Dynamic Physical Therapy Chicago River North team since 2019. She enjoys problem-solving with her patients and designing treatment programs specific to their unique circumstances and goals. She aims to create a holistic experience so that her patients are fully equipped with the knowledge, ability and confidence to get back to doing what they love, stronger than before. She may use manual treatments, dry needling, therapeutic exercise, postural/behavioral/ergonomic modification, and gait analysis to help with the process. Mary has personally recovered from a hip labral repair and various running injuries in the past which helps make her an expert at orthopedic issues such as hip, knee and back pain. Outside of the clinic, she stays active with soccer, yoga and running.
